ADJ
big, special
We owe a special thanks to the volunteers who helped organize the charity event last weekend.
heartfelt, sincere, warm
grateful
VERB + THANKS
express, give, say
She gave thanks before the meal and told everyone how grateful she felt.
nod, smile
He nodded his thanks to the waiter who brought the coffee to his table.
get, receive
She received thanks from her boss for completing the project ahead of schedule.
accept
deserve
The hard work of our volunteers truly deserves thanks from everyone in the community.
THANKS + VERB
go to sb
Thanks go to my teacher for helping me prepare for the exam.
PREP
as/in ~ for
She gave him a small gift as thanks for helping her move to the new apartment.
~ to
We owe our success to the hard work of everyone on the team, and we give thanks to them all.
PHRASES
a letter/vote/word of thanks
She wrote a brief letter of thanks to her neighbor for helping during the move.
many thanks
Many thanks for helping me move into my new apartment yesterday.
thanks be to God
My family is safe after the accident, thanks be to God.
